mysql怎么导入frm
时间 : 2023-08-03 17:41:02声明: : 文章内容来自网络,不保证准确性,请自行甄别信息有效性
要导入`.frm`文件,需要使用`mysqlfrm`工具,这是MySQL官方提供的一个命令行工具。下面是导入`.frm`文件的步骤:
1. 首先,确保你已经安装了MySQL服务器和`mysqlfrm`工具。如果没有安装,可以通过以下命令安装:
```shell
sudo apt-get install mysql-server mysql-client
```
然后,下载`mysqlfrm`工具并解压到合适的位置。你可以在MySQL官方网站上找到适合你系统的版本。
2. 打开终端,并导航到`mysqlfrm`工具所在的目录。
3. 运行以下命令导入`.frm`文件:
```shell
./mysqlfrm --diagnostic path_to_frm_file
```
其中,`path_to_frm_file`是你要导入的`.frm`文件的路径。
4. `mysqlfrm`工具会分析`.frm`文件,并生成一个`.sql`文件,该文件包含了数据表的结构。
5. 在MySQL服务器上创建一个新的数据库或选择一个已存在的数据库。
6. 使用`mysql`命令行工具登录到MySQL服务器:
```shell
mysql -u root -p
```
这将提示你输入MySQL root用户的密码。
7. 在MySQL命令提示符下,使用`source`命令导入`.sql`文件:
```mysql
source path_to_generated_sql_file
```
其中,`path_to_generated_sql_file`是由`mysqlfrm`工具生成的`.sql`文件的路径。
这将导入数据表的结构到MySQL数据库。
注意事项:
- `.frm`文件是存储数据表结构的文件,不包含具体的数据记录。因此,导入`.frm`文件后,你需要导入数据记录,否则数据表将是空的。
- 导入`.frm`文件前,请确保MySQL服务器版本与`.frm`文件的版本兼容。
- 如果`.frm`文件受到损坏或不匹配,`mysqlfrm`工具可能无法正确导入数据表结构。在这种情况下,你可能需要尝试其他方法来恢复数据表结构。
https/SSL证书广告优选IDC>>
推荐主题模板更多>>
推荐文章